General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.451(b)(1): Each platform on all working levels of scaffolds was not fully planked or decked between the front uprights and the guardrail supports as specified in paragraphs 1926.451(b)(1)(i)-(ii) On or about March 30, 2018, subcontractors employees were exposed to a fall of approximately 35 feet. The subcontractors employees were installing stucco materials on a new apartment building located at 3600 Park East Drive, Beachwood, Ohio 44122. The subcontractors employees were working on upper levels of the scaffold that were not fully planked.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.451(g)(1): Employees on scaffolds more than 10 feet (3.1 m) above a lower level were not protected from falling to that lower level by fall protection established in paragraphs (g)(1)(i)-(vii) of this section: On or about March 30, 2018, subcontractors employees were exposed to a fall of approximately 35 feet. The subcontractors employees were installing stucco materials on a new apartment building located at 3600 Park East Drive, Beachwood, Ohio 44122. The subcontractors employees were working on upper levels of the scaffold without a complete guard rail system in place.
